Over the past month, a hairstylist has had 49 female clients and 21 male clients. What is the ratio of male clients to female clients for this hairstylist?

Answers

Answer 1
The ratio is 21:49, 21/49, or 21 to 49
Answer 2

The ratio of male clients to female clients for the hairstylist is 21:49, which simplifies to 3:7 after dividing both numbers by the GCD of 7.

The question asks to find the ratio of male clients to female clients for a hairstylist. In this scenario, the hairstylist has had 49 female clients and 21 male clients. To find the ratio of male to female clients, we compare the number of male clients to the number of female clients.

The ratio is expressed as male clients : female clients. Thus, the ratio of male clients to female clients is:

21 male clients : 49 female clients

To simplify the ratio, we find the greatest common divisor (GCD) of 21 and 49, which is 7. Dividing both numbers by 7, we get:

3 male clients : 7 female clients

The scale on a map is 1 cm:35 mi. The distance on the map between Los Angeles, CA, and San Francisco, CA, is 10.8 cm. What is the actual distance between Los Angeles and San Francisco?

Answers

It is 378 miles. :)
this is answer

Step 1: Let us assign variable for the unknown that we need to find.

' x ' be the actual distance between Los Angeles and San Francisco

Step 2: Set up an equation based on the given statement "The scale on a map is 1 cm:35 mi. The distance on the map between Los Angeles, CA, and San Francisco, CA, is 10.8 cm."

[tex] \frac{distance \; in \; cm}{distance\; in\; miles}=\frac{1}{35}=\frac{10.8}{x} \\ \\ Cross \; Multiply\\ \\ 1 \cdot x = 35 \cdot 10.8\\ \\ x = 378 [/tex]

Conclusion:

The actual distance between Los Angeles and San Francisco is 378 miles.

Suppose given an isosceles triangle with a leg measuring 5 in. Two lines are drawn through some point on the base, each parallel to one of the legs. Find the perimeter of the constructed parallelogram.

Answers

Let ΔABC be isosceles triangle with legs AB=BC=5 in. Draw an arbitrary point D on the base AC and spend two lines DE and DF such that DE || BC and DF || AB.

You get the parallelogram BFDE.

1. Consider ΔAED. This triangle is isosceles, because ∠ADE≅∠ACB as corresponding angles at parallel lines. The legs of this triangle are AE=ED.

2. Consider ΔDFC. This triangle is isosceles, because ∠FDC≅∠BAC as corresponding angles at parallel lines. The legs of this triangle are DF=FC.

3. Find the perimeter of parallelogram BFDE.

[tex]P_{BFDE}=BF+FD+ED+BE.[/tex]

Since AE=ED and DF=FC, you have that

[tex]P_{BFDE}=BF+FC+AE+BE=AB+BC=5+5=10\ in.[/tex]

Answer: 10 in.
